ESL/EFL Faculty Position - INTERLINK Language Center

PROGRAM DESCRIPTION:

INTERLINK Language Centers (ILC) provides intensive English language training, academic preparation, and cross-cultural orientation programs on diverse American university campuses. In September 2004, it opened its first overseas center at Al-Yamamah College in Riyadh, Saudi Arabia.

An all-male, five-year institution of higher education, Al Yamamah College offers an American-style curriculum (in English) specializing in six areas of business. In partnership with Al Yamamah, INTERLINK provides intensive English and academic preparation programs for students before they start their business studies and business English throughout the students' first year of academic study.

The Saudi INTERLINK program is based on the same student-centered philosophy of experiential, heuristic, needs-based learning as INTERLINK uses in its US centers. A carefully selected faculty engage a wide variety of skills and talents to provide the best possible learning experiences for Saudi students. First-rate teaching facilities and support services are available for the faculty.

RESPONSIBILITIES: The faculty's primary responsibility is to help students learn English either in preparation for taking academic courses at the College, or for improving English for professional and personal purposes. Responsibilities include 20 hours of weekly EFL instruction, advising students on their progress, assisting students with study skills/learning strategies, and participating in program meetings and college committees. This instruction may also involve outside institutions including government agencies, the business community, or the general public. When teaching assignments involve both Al Yamamah students and other students, scheduling will try to minimize gaps between day and evening class times. Secondary duties consist of assisting program administrators with curriculum review, revision and on-going assessment, orientation, scheduling, placement, and materials review and development.

POSITION REQUIREMENTS AND QUALIFICATIONS:

* Genuine commitment to the student, the profession and to the philosophy espoused by INTERLINK and Al Yamamah College
* MA in ESOL or Applied Linguistics
(Non-native speakers' undergraduate and graduate degrees must be from an English-speaking country; they must have near-native proficiency in English; and must have ESL teaching experience at an IEP in an English-speaking country)
* Two or more years of intensive teaching experience in ESL or EFL environments
(Non-native applicants must have this experience in an English-speaking country)
* Ability to work with all levels, ranging from very basic to advanced
* Willingness to use innovative approaches, including project-based, experiential learning and student-centered curricula
* Superior verbal, written, interpersonal skills and interest in cross-cultural learning and training
* Ability to accept cultural differences and adapt to a way of life requiring understanding, conformity and flexibility
* Proficiency in computer skills, including Internet, PowerPoint, Word, Excel, and Access (CALL a plus)
* Candidates with Peace Corps experience, proficiency in another language, publications or work experience in the Middle East will be given preference and additional compensation.
* Male (since Al-Yamamah is an all-male College)
* 55 years of age or under due to the governmentís mandatory retirement regulations

SALARY AND BENEFITS:

Salary will be commensurate with qualifications, ranging between $34,000 and $37,000 per annum. The benefit package includes round-trip transportation to and from Saudi Arabia; free furnished housing; medical insurance coverage; paid 30-day annual leave with international transportation; local transportation to and from the College; local holidays; annually renewable contract; 5% contract completion bonus; and 5% contract renewal bonus.
